Central Symptoms Predict Post-Treatment Outcomes and Clinical Impairment in Anorexia Nervosa: A Network Analysis in a Randomized-Controlled Trial
2018-11-13
Abstract excerpt
<p>Background: Anorexia nervosa (AN) is a serious mental disorder associated with high levels of psychological comorbidity, physical complications, and mortality. Treatment outcomes for AN with best available psychological therapies remain poor.
